Rhododendron park in Helsinki

There’s a hidden gem in Helsinki, that you just must see! A place called Alppiruusupuisto, a park in the middle of forest, full of blooming rhododendron and azalea.

The park was established in 1975, over 3000 rhododendron were planted for research purposes.

For couple of weeks in the beginning of June, thousands of flowers bloom and there’s amazing scent everywhere.

The park is open 24/7 and it’s free. Thanks to the night-less summer nights, you can go for a stroll in the middle of the night if you feel like it.

You can reach the park in half an hour from Helsinki railway station with train or by bus.
